What We Look for in Best Acne Pads
When we began our testing, we looked for more than just a high percentage of salicylic acid. Our team recommends focusing on the “carrier” ingredients. We look for formulas that exclude harsh denatured alcohols when possible, as we found these often cause more harm than good by triggering excess oil production.
We also pay close attention to the pad material itself. In our experience, a pad that is too smooth won’t grab the dead skin cells, while one that is too rough can cause micro-tears. The best acne pads feature a dual-textured design or a high-quality quilted fabric that delivers the formula evenly across the skin.
How We Choose the Right Best Acne Pads
Choosing the right product comes down to your specific skin “personality.” During our projects, we discovered that users with combination skin benefit most from using different pads on different areas—perhaps an Oxy pad for the oily chin and a Thayers pad for the dryer cheeks.
Our team recommends starting with a lower frequency—once every other day—to see how your skin reacts. We found that the biggest mistake users make is over-cleansing, which leads to irritation. Always look for a count that fits your lifestyle; if you travel often, look for smaller tubs or pads that retain moisture well over time.

Can we use these pads every single day?
In our experience, most users can work up to daily use, but we recommend starting slowly. If you have oily skin, once or twice a day is usually fine. However, if you notice any peeling or excessive tightness, we suggest cutting back to every other day until your skin builds up a tolerance to the acid.
Do these pads replace a regular face wash?
We found that while these pads are great at removing surface dirt and oil, they work best as a second step. We recommend using a gentle cleanser first to remove the bulk of your makeup or sweat, then using the pad to deliver the acne-fighting medication directly into the now-clear pores.
Should we moisturize after using an acne pad?
Yes, we absolutely recommend moisturizing. Even the most “moisturizing” acne pads contain acids that can slightly dehydrate the skin. To maintain a healthy glow, we found that applying a lightweight, oil-free moisturizer about five minutes after the pad has dried helps lock in the treatment while keeping the skin soft.
Are alcohol-free acne pads really better?
From our testing, we found that alcohol-free pads are generally better for long-term use. While alcohol provides a “clean” feeling and helps ingredients penetrate, it can damage the skin barrier over time. We noticed fewer instances of redness and flaking when we used alcohol-free options like Stridex or Thayers.
